WHAT LEVEL OF REVELATION?


MEMORY VERSE: And he said, I beseech thee, shew me thy glory. Exodus 33:18
BIBLE IN ONE YEAR: Job 27-28
There are different levels of knowledge. Take for instance, the knowledge of a particular brand of car called ‘Mercedes Benz’. There are different levels of knowledge of a Mercedes Benz car. Firstly, there are people who have no knowledge of Mercedes Benz at all. Some have never heard that name before in their life. You may find it hard to believe but there are some indigenous tribes in the Amazon rain-forest who don’t wear clothes. They have never seen a car in their life talk-less of know a Mercedes Benz car or any car whatsoever. Secondly, there are some of us who know Mercedes Benz. Although, we may not be opportuned to see them every day like those who live in big cities but at least, we can tell the difference between a Mercedes Benz and Toyota or BMW. Thirdly, there are some who own or drive a Mercedes Benz car. These people know Mercedes Benz at least better than some of us who don’t own a car and definitely, far better than our brothers and sisters in the Amazon rain-forests. Lastly, there are people who make Mercedes Benz cars. These are the people, who we can say, truly knows Mercedes Benz. If a Mercedes Benz develops fault, they know what is wrong with it and can fix it.
This applies to humans too. Take for instance the Prime Minister (PM). There are people who have never heard of the PM in their life. They don't even know if a country called England exists. These people don’t have any knowledge of him. Secondly, there are people who have seen his picture, probably in the newspaper or poster. These people know the PM to some extent. Thirdly, there are people who went to the same school or worked with the PM. These people know the PM better than those of us who see him on TV, and definitely far better than those good people in the Amazon rain-forests. Fourthly, there are the PM's family and friends. These people, especially parents, know the PM better his colleagues. They raised the PM. They watched him grow from a boy to become a man. Fifthly, there is the wife. She knows a lot about the PM especially intimate things. This is because they share the same bedroom. But God, who created the PM, knows the PM more than himself. He knows the PM's future.
Just as our knowledge of people or things are in levels, so also our knowledge of God. Firstly, there are people who don't believe in God. Secondly, there are people who believe in God’s existence, they may or may not practice any religion. To some extent, these people know God. Thirdly, there are people who have read the bible or go to church. These people know God and they can say a thing or two about God e.g. they know God is love. Fourthly, there are people who have experienced God's power, maybe they had a serious challenge and God came through for them or they received a miracle. These people know God at least better than people who believe God exists. Fifthly, there are people who have walked with God for several years e.g. Enoch, Moses, etc. They are regularly led by the Spirit of God. They even hear the audible voice of God once in a while. The bible records that Moses spoke to God face to face like a man speaks to his friend ( Exodus 33:11). That is a very deep knowledge of God. Beyond this very deep knowledge of God is yet a deeper knowledge of God. Exodus 33:18 says, “And he said, I beseech thee, shew me thy glory.” Except God, Himself, reveals His glory unto us, we have not truly known the Lord.
NOTE: Although, there are still more revelations that awaits us in heaven, but whilst we are here on earth, we must yearn to behold the glory of the Lord.
PRAYER POINT: Father, show me your glory.

SUFFERING IN SILENCE?

MEMORY VERSE: And it came to pass at the end of the four hundred and thirty years, even the selfsame day it came to pass, that all the hosts of the LORD went out from the land of Egypt. Exodus 12:41
BIBLE IN ONE YEAR: 1 Samuel 16-20
There is a time for ‘everything’ under the heavens (Ecclesiastes 3:1). According to Ecclesiastes 3:2-8, there is a time to be born and there is a time die. There is a time to keep silent, and a time to speak and so on. This brings us to this question, ‘who controls time?’ God. Daniel 2:21 says, “And he changeth the times and the seasons: he removeth kings, and setteth up kings: he giveth wisdom unto the wise, and knowledge to them that know understanding:” The Most High God decides when one faces his or her trial of faith. Matthew 4:1 says, “Then was Jesus led up of the Spirit into the wilderness to be tempted of the devil.” Trails of faith have so many advantages. For instance, they are opportunity for spiritual maturity (James 1:3). Not only that, you will never know the great things that God has deposited inside you until you face some challenges. David never knew he had the potential to kill a lion and bear with his bare hands until a bear and lion tried to steal his sheep (1 Samuel 17:34). The Lord determines how long the trial of faith will last for. Genesis 15:13 says, “And he said unto Abram, Know of a surety that thy seed shall be a stranger in a land that is not theirs, and shall serve them; and they shall afflict them four hundred years.” He determines when one's waiting period comes to an end. In Genesis 18, during God’s visit to Abraham, He told Sarah that her waiting period was over. Verse 14 says, “Is any thing too hard for the LORD? At the time appointed I will return unto thee, according to the time of life, and Sarah shall have a son.”
One may ask, ‘how about when something evil happens, does God decide that?’ God does not do evil. Job 34:12 says, “Yea, surely God will not do wickedly, neither will the Almighty pervert judgment.” Although God does not do evil, nothing happens except He allows it and He will not allow something He cannot use. In His infinite wisdom, He allows some things so as to bring a testimony out of it. Although God cannot be stopped, when He wants to work in our lives He expects our cooperation. God’s initial plan was that the children of Israel will spend 400 years in Egypt but they spent 430 years. Exodus 12:41 says, “And it came to pass at the end of the four hundred and thirty years, even the selfsame day it came to pass, that all the hosts of the LORD went out from the land of Egypt.” Why? When the children of Israel were supposed to cry to God for deliverance, they kept quiet. Matthew 7:7-8 says, “Ask, and it shall be given you; seek and you shall find; knock, and it shall be given you: for every one that asketh recieveth: and he that seeketh findeth; and to him that knocketh it shall be opened.” Even when Pharaoh was killing all their male children, they just kept quiet. It is baffling that people can be suffering to the point of losing their children and still keep quiet. Not until they cried to God, their situation did not change. Are you suffering in silence? There is nothing spiritual in people taking advantage of you and you keep quiet. No! It is time to cry to God to fight your cause! It is time to cry to God to defend you! It is time to cry to God to fight your battle for you! As far as one keeps quiet, things will not change.
NOTE: Stop asking God if He can’t see what you are going through. Report the matter to Him!
PRAYER POINT: Father, fight for me today.

COPYING OTHER NATIONS?

MEMORY VERSE: Thy father made our yoke grievous: now therefore make thou the grievous service of thy father, and his heavy yoke which he put upon us, lighter, and we will serve thee. 1 Kings 12:4
BIBLE IN ONE YEAR: 1 Corinthians 9-10
READ: 1 Samuel 8:1-22
God’s ways are different from the ways of man. Isaiah 55:9 says, “For as the heavens are higher than the earth, So are My ways higher than your ways And My thoughts than your thoughts.” Because God is Omniscient, He knows the best way to run one’s life, a marriage, a ministry or a nation. Instead of giving Israel a human king, He deliberately appointed judges, prophets and prophetess over them but the children of Israel did not want that. They wanted to be like the neighboring nations who had a human king (1 Samuel 8:5). When the sons of Samuel, Joel and Abijah, began to accept bribe and pervert judgment, the elders of Israel used that as an opportunity to demand for a king from Samuel. Samuel knew that they wanted to do things how ‘others’ did them not how God wants it to be done and he was unhappy. After bringing the matter to God, he warned them of the dangers of leaving ‘God’s way of ruling them’ and copying other nations. He strictly warned them that a human king will put them in bondage and make life unbearable for them, but they refused to listen. As it is in the nature of God not to force Himself on anyone, He gave them the human king they requested and they suffered under him. At a point, they had to meet the king and beg him to reduce the burden on them. 1 Kings 12:4 says, “Thy father made our yoke grievous: now therefore make thou the grievous service of thy father, and his heavy yoke which he put upon us, lighter, and we will serve thee.”
